From the hotel, explore the city's many historic monuments, such as the Lutèce arenas (a Gallo-Roman amphitheatre), Notre-Dame Cathedral, the Sorbonne, the Jardin des Plantes and the Galerie de l'Evolution and the Manufacture des Gobelins.
The 5th arrondissement of Paris is one of the oldest in the city, covering most of the Latin Quarter which was built by the Romans.
